Sie arbeiten, indem sie einen Lichtstrahl \u2013 h\u00e4ufig Infrarot oder sichtbares Licht \u2013 aussenden und Ver\u00e4nderungen im Lichtpfad \u00fcberwachen, die durch ein Objekt verursacht werden. Der Sender sendet einen kontinuierlichen Lichtstrahl zum Empf\u00e4nger. Wenn ein Objekt diesen Strahl unterbricht, erkennt der Empf\u00e4nger den Lichtausfall und signalisiert die Anwesenheit des Objekts. Durchstrahlungssensoren bieten eine hohe Genauigkeit und eignen sich f\u00fcr die Erkennung \u00fcber gro\u00dfe Entfernungen.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-7a3b6ec el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"7a3b6ec\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p><strong>Reflexionslichtschranken<\/strong>: In dieser Konfiguration sind Sender und Empf\u00e4nger in einem Geh\u00e4use untergebracht, und ein Reflektor wird gegen\u00fcber positioniert. Der Sender sendet einen Lichtstrahl zum Reflektor, der das Licht zur\u00fcck zum Empf\u00e4nger reflektiert. Ein Objekt wird erkannt, wenn es den reflektierten Strahl unterbricht. Reflexionslichtschranken sind effizient f\u00fcr Anwendungen im mittleren Entfernungsbereich und relativ einfach zu installieren.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-f063d93 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"f063d93\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p><strong>Diffuse Sensoren<\/strong>: Hier befinden sich Sender und Empf\u00e4nger in einer einzigen Einheit. Der Sender emittiert einen Lichtstrahl, der vom Zielobjekt zur\u00fcck zum Empf\u00e4nger reflektiert wird. Der Sensor erkennt das Objekt basierend auf der Intensit\u00e4t des reflektierten Lichts.
